  3. Day 3 Delhi to Mandawa | The Open-Air Art Gallery

    After breakfast, drive to Mandawa in the Shekhawati region, a journey of around six hours through the villages and farmland of north Rajasthan.

    Shekhawati is famous for its merchant havelis, decorated with colourful frescoes of gods, trains, royal processions and everyday life. Later in the afternoon, take a guided walk through Mandawa’s lanes to see the finest of these painted mansions.

    Overnight: Mandawa

  4. Day 4 Mandawa to Bikaner | Junagarh Fort

    After breakfast, continue to Bikaner, a historic desert city on the old caravan routes.

    Visit the impressive Junagarh Fort, known for its richly decorated palaces, mirror work and carved stone balconies. Later, explore the old city and its busy bazaars, famous for sweets and namkeen.

    You may also choose an optional visit to the Karni Mata Temple at Deshnoke, a short drive from the city.

    Overnight: Bikaner

  6. Day 6 Jaisalmer | Golden Fort & Desert Sunset

    After breakfast, explore Jaisalmer Fort, one of the few living forts in the world, with homes, temples and shops still inside its walls.

    Visit the intricately carved Patwon Ki Haveli and the peaceful Gadisar Lake. In the afternoon, head to the sand dunes for a camel ride at sunset, followed by an optional evening of Rajasthani folk music and dinner at a desert camp.

    Overnight: Jaisalmer

  8. Day 8 Jodhpur to Udaipur via Ranakpur

    After breakfast, depart for Udaipur through the Aravalli hills.

    En route, visit the Jain temples of Ranakpur, celebrated for their hundreds of intricately carved marble pillars, no two of which are said to be alike.

    Continue to Udaipur and check in to your hotel.

    Overnight: Udaipur
